Follow-up from the Quillbarn admin outage: bulk edits in the tenant table were firing one write per row, which hammered the primary. New folks, please route bulk operations through the batcher helper instead of looping. We also added guardrails so oversized selections get chunked automatically. The batcher reads its limits from the constants defined here.

constants for tafog-tawef:
CAPS = {
    "rusiel": 965,
    "wenox": 448,
    "gilael": 551,
    "quenius": 1007,
    "holeth": 546,
}

[ ] FD-leak verification — Before tagging the Quillbarrow 3.2 release, confirm the file-descriptor leak in the archive worker is fully resolved. Run the 12-hour soak on the Tarnview staging cluster, watch the descriptor count stay flat under churn, and have QA sign off on the lsof deltas. If the count climbs past baseline, the release is blocked, no exceptions. Record the soak results in the release folder. The soak was run against the build identified below.

session token of tajef-bageg = htk21_5d90d574934f3ccae6437

Step 7: Query planner regression. Upgrading Marrowbase to 5.2 changes the default join-ordering heuristic, which previously masked an unsafe predicate-pushdown path flagged in the last audit. Security reviewers should confirm the pushdown guard remains enforced after migration. The planner must run with the settings shown below.

settings of fafog-haduf:
ZORIX_PIN=4648
ZORIX_METRICS_HOST=metrics.zorix.paliqsys.corp
ZORIX_LOG_LEVEL=info
ZORIX_TENANT=druix

- [ ] **Step 7: Breaker override escrow.** After sealing the signing keys for the Tallgrove upstream API circuit breaker, confirm the support team can force the breaker open during a full outage. The override bundle lives in the sealed escrow drawer and is useless without its unlock phrase. Two ceremony witnesses must initial this step before proceeding. The escrow bundle is decrypted with the recovery passphrase that follows.

vault phrase of kahip-kahop = holath-quenmir